The Body problem

The BMW 650i gran coupe experienced a trunk release failure on 6/4/2023. The emergency release handle is in the very rear of the trunk. The Door problem

The contact owns a 2014 BMW 650i. The contact stated that the front driver's door failed to open. The contact stated that the central locking system and key failed to unlock the doors. The Structure problem

The contact owns a 2006 BMW 650i. While the vehicle was parked the contact noticed a light on the instrument panel indicating the convertible top was not locked.
